PG can in the begining cause irritations such as itching. I suffered with itching in the begining but after taking anti-histamines for a few weeks the itching went away.
VG can cause congestion, I know if I use more than 50% VG in my mixes my lungs feel severely congested.
36mg nic strength I would class as extra high. I started on 36mg but after a couple of weeks of restlessness, mild headaches and twitching when I went to bed I found out that these symptoms were due to vaping high nic and so I had to cut back.
Problem was that my comfortable spot was 20mg only it did'nt satisfy me at all, it just did'nt hit hard enough. But rather than headaches and body poping in my sleep I perservered.
Acouple of months into vaping I bought a GDPT and tried 5v vaping for the first time, and wow what a hit, in fact when I was out and about with my Screwdriver MK2 I could'nt wait to get home to switch to my GDPT.
I now vape at 5v exclusively GDPT at home and my Box 101 on the go and have to say I'm very satisfied now, and no more headaches and twitching.

To date my own experimentation has involved the use of F'art, DV, LorAnn, Cloud 9 and Asda Rum. I am however looking forward to trying flavourings from TPA and Flavour West in the near future.
As I mention in my post on mixing not all flavourings are equal, that's not to say that one vendors flavourings are better than anothers, It just means that there are good flavours and there are not so good flavours from all vendors.
It's all trial and error when looking for a good flavour, for example, as I mention in my post, in my search for chocolate flavourings I found only 3 out of 6 that I tried that resembled chocolate, and one of those is more like cocoa.
Also I found that although a particular brand of chocolate went well in one recipe it did'nt suit another and so I had to use a different chocolate for that.
My only frustration is not being able to find decent White Rum and Dark Rum flavourings, for Dark Rum I was very happy with LorAnn Butter Rum but you ca'nt get it anymore outside of the US, also they wo'nt ship it due it having a high flash point. For a White Rum Flavouring, as I've mentioned, I use Asda Rum flavouring, not by choice but because there is'nt anything else available.
So you really do have to experiment with flavourings from different vendors untill you find what is best for you. It's also worth mentioning that as taste is subjective what one person finds to be a good flavouring from a particular vendor may not suit someone else.
